10X Chromium single-cell RNA sequencing of the hematopoietic system and niche cells of young and old female individuals from four distinct mouse species
Ontology highlight
ABSTRACT: The aim of this study was to analyse the evolutionary conservation or divergence of the aging murine hematopoietic system, which includes hematopoietic stem and progenitor cells (HSPCs) and stromal cells from the hematopoietic niche. The animals used were young (10-13 weeks) and old (84-109 weeks) female individuals from four mouse species: Mus musculus strains C57BL/6J or C57BL/6J-Ly5.1 (BL6), Mus musculus castaneus (CAST/EiJ), Mus spretus (SPRET/EiJ), and Mus caroli (CAROLI/EiJ). We isolated HSPC and niche cells from each animal and performed scRNAseq using the 10X Genomics platform. For alignment, we generated a reference genome based on the mm10 genome masked with Ns in positions of SNVs between species.
